Several types of connectivity choices are typically employed in smart cities, every with unique traits and capabilities. Cellular networks, for example, offer widespread coverage and better knowledge throughput. They enable IoT units to speak efficiently, particularly in areas where different forms of connectivity could additionally be restricted. Many smart city applications depend on cellular technology to make sure constant knowledge streaming and interaction.


Low-Power Wide-Area Networks, or LPWAN, is one other prominent choice. This expertise is designed specifically for low-bandwidth and low-power purposes. LPWAN is particularly useful for sensor information, making it best for smart agriculture, waste administration, and environmental monitoring. The long-range capabilities of LPWAN additionally mean fewer base stations are required, making deployment extra economical.


Wi-Fi is often used for connecting units in more localized smart metropolis deployments. This option is effective for city areas with existing infrastructure, permitting varied devices to connect with out incurring significant costs. However, Wi-Fi connections can battle by way of vary and battery life for distant IoT units. Solutions to boost Wi-Fi protection can include mesh networks that reach connectivity.

Another notable interplay know-how employed in smart cities is Zigbee. This low-power, short-range wi-fi communication standard serves numerous functions from lighting methods to residence automation. Zigbee is particularly helpful in dense urban settings the place many devices are in shut proximity to one another, offering a robust choice for native mesh networks.

Bluetooth can additionally be making vital inroads in the smart city landscape. Its low energy consumption and ease of use make it a preferred alternative for connecting private units to city infrastructure. Applications such as smart parking techniques and public transport apps make the most of Bluetooth connectivity to streamline companies for users.


Fiber optic networks provide another layer of IoT connectivity options, especially for the spine infrastructure of smart cities. They help high data switch charges and may handle substantial quantities of knowledge from numerous sensors and systems. This possibility is significant for central knowledge facilities, guaranteeing that the immense amount of data generated by smart metropolis units is efficiently processed.


The integration of satellite tv for pc know-how is a growing trends, particularly for rural or underconnected areas. This choice allows cities to achieve far-flung gadgets that traditional networks may not service successfully. While satellite connectivity is most likely not as low in latency as different options, it's essential for complete smart metropolis coverage.

    What are the most typical IoT connectivity options for smart cities?





Common IoT connectivity choices for smart cities include cellular networks (like 4G/5G), LPWAN (Low Power Wide Area Network) technologies corresponding to LoRaWAN and Sigfox, Wi-Fi, and Bluetooth. Each has its strengths, serving varied purposes depending on vary, power consumption, and knowledge rate necessities.


How does 5G improve IoT connectivity in city areas?


5G enhances IoT connectivity by offering sooner knowledge switch speeds, lower latency, and the flexibility to content connect a large number of units simultaneously. This is essential for applications like smart visitors administration and real-time public safety monitoring, thereby bettering general city efficiency.

What role does LPWAN play in smart metropolis applications?




LPWAN is designed particularly for low-power, long-range communication, making it perfect for battery-operated sensors and units in smart cities. LPWAN can assist wide-area protection with minimal energy consumption, which is particularly helpful for purposes like waste management and environmental monitoring.
